An acidity scale of phosphonium tetraphenylborate salts and ruthenium dihydrogen complexes in dichloromethane

Abstract

Equilibrium constants (K DM ) for reactions between acids and bases of the title compounds in CD 2 Cl 2 (DM) have been determined by 31 P and 1 H NMR spectroscopy at room temperature. [HPCy 3 ]BPh 4 and [HPCy 3 ]BF 4 , with pK DM assigned by literature convention to 9.7, have been used as the anchor compounds for the pK DM determinations. A continuous scale of pK DM values covering the range 9.7 to 5.7 is created with the acidic compounds [HPR 3 ]BPh 4 . Those acids with pK DM greater than 6 are stable, while those with more acidic cations HPR 3 + protonate BPh 4 – to produce R 3 PBPh 3 and benzene. The literature pK THF values reported for [HPBu 2 Ph]BPh 4 , [HPMePh 2 ]BPh 4 , and [HPEtPh 2 ]BPh 4 are questionable because of this protonation reaction. NOE and PGSE 1 H NMR techniques are used to show that [HPCy 2 Ph]BPh 4 in DM exists as ion pairs and higher aggregates up to quadrupoles at the concentrations used in the acid–base studies. The new dihydrogen complexes [Ru(H 2 )Cl(PPh 3 ) 2 (dach)]BF 4 (dach = (1R,2R)-(–)-diaminocyclohexane) and [Ru(H 2 )Cl{tmeP 2 (NH) 2 }]BF 4 (tmeP 2 (NH) 2 = PPh 2 C 6 H 4 CH 2 NHCMe 2 CMe 2 NHCH 2 C 6 H 4 PPh 2 ) were prepared by reaction of RuHCl(PPh 3 ) 2 (dach) and RuHCl{tmeP 2 (NH) 2 } with HBF 4 . Their crystal structures are reported, and the pK DM values of their BPh 4 – salts were determined to be 8.6 and 6.9, respectively.Key words: acidity, dihydrogen complex, hydride, phosphonium, dichloromethane.
